25E-NBOH (2C-E-NBOH)
Forensic and Analytical Overview
1. Chemical Identification
Common name: 25E-NBOH
Systematic name: 2-(4-Ethoxy-2,5-dimethoxyphenyl)-N-[(2-hydroxybenzyl)]ethanamine
Chemical class: Substituted phenethylamine (NBOH series)
Molecular formula: C₁₈H₂₃NO₄
Molecular weight: ≈317.38 g/mol
Structural relation: The N-hydroxybenzyl analogue of 2C-E; closely related to the NBOMe series (e.g., 25I-NBOMe, 25C-NBOH).
2. Background
25E-NBOH belongs to the NBOH family of phenethylamines, a group of compounds derived from 2C-series hallucinogens.It first appeared in analytical literature in the early 2010s in connection with forensic casework and toxicological screenings of emerging novel psychoactive substances (NPS).The compound has no approved medical or therapeutic use and is regulated under controlled substance or analogue laws in many countries.
3. Analytical Characterization
Forensic identification of 25E-NBOH typically employs:
Gas Chromatography–Mass Spectrometry (GC–MS)
Liquid Chromatography–Mass Spectrometry (LC–MS or LC-QTOF)
Infrared (IR) spectroscopy for functional group confirmation
Nuclear Magnetic Resonance (NMR) for structural elucidation
UV-Vis and fluorescence spectroscopy for trace and residue detection
Distinctive fragmentation patterns (including the hydroxybenzyl moiety) aid in differentiation from related NBOMe or 2C-series compounds.
